Furthermore, what side do you get a lip piercing?

Ahead, his expert advice for what you should know before getting your lip pierced.

  1. Placement: Popular placements include under the bottom lip, centered on the indent beneath the nostrils, side of the upper lip.
  2. Pricing: $30-$40, not including the cost of the jewelry.
  3. Pain Level: 4/10.
  4. Healing Time: Three to six months.
People also ask, can I get my lip pierced? A lip will almost always be pierced with a captive bead ring (or a flat back labret) because other rings have a seam that can get caught in the healing tissue. When you go to have the jewelry downsized you can switch the jewelry to a different type of ring or flatback.

Likewise, why you shouldn’t get a lip piercing?

Potential dangers and problems could include: Infections: These can be caused by improperly disinfected piercing tools, an unsterile piercing environment or improper aftercare. Your mouth is home to large amounts of bacteria; proper aftercare will help ensure your piercing site stays clean.
